WebApr 18, 2024 · Intercropping different celery varieties with cucumbers had significant repellent effects and oviposition deterrent effects in whiteflies. Results obtained demonstrated that the Western Europe celery varieties, Juventus and Ventura, and the Chinese celery variety, Jinnan, had good repellent efficacy against the whitefly. WebSoil for growing celery should have liberal amounts of compost and well-rotted leaves or aged manure added. In addition, celery benefits from regular applications of organic 5-10-10 fertilizer. Apply about one tablespoon per plant, sprinkled in a shallow furrow about three inches away and covered with soil. Water in well.

WebBasic requirements Celery is a cool season vegetable which grows best in cool climates in well-draining, fertile soils with a pH between 6.0 and 6.8.. Celery plants grow optimally in cool, moist locations and will tolerate some shade but will not tolerate heat.
